Video shows Ukraine drone attack on Russian warplanes
Ukraine attacked four Russian airbases with more than 100 explosive drones smuggled inside containers that had been trucked deep inside the country by drivers unaware of what was in their cargo. The attack was planned over 18 months and destroyed or damaged several nuclear-capable long-range bombers. The targeted aircraft is the type that Russia has used to fire cruise missiles into Ukraine, including many civilian targets. Ukraine officials said the attack was on “absolutely legitimate” military targets.
